Multi-monitor
In some cases, it is reported to work perfectly fine out of the box, but in several cases, especially with ATI cards, the game does not seem to recognize any resolution beyond a single monitor. A specific game launcher, called RomTerraria 2.0 will allow you to launch the game at the desired resolution.
Custom Resolution Support
RomTerraria 2.0 is a launcher and trainer that provides support for widescreen/custom resolutions, plus many other features such as adding a local minimap, world map, cheat options, embed real-time clock, and more.

XNA/.NET Installation Issues
- Make sure to install .NET 4 before installing XNA 4. If that does not solve the issue, try uninstalling both of these and installing a clean copy of both.

German version
The German (Steam) version of Terraria has currently lots of bugs and crashes (for example social slot items), the only fix is to set the language to English.
